#63ba58 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#63ba58 is composed of 38.8% red, 72.9%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 46.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 52.7% yellow and 27.1% black. It has a hue angle of 113.3 degrees, a saturation of 41.5% and a lightness of 53.7%. #63ba58 color hex could be obtained by blending #c6ffb0 with #007500.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

● #63ba58 color description : Moderate lime green.
#63ba58 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#63ba58 has RGB values of R:99, G:186,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0.47, M:0, Y:0.53,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 6535768.

Shades and Tints of #63ba58
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060d06 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.
